asic-lookup-mcp

An MCP server that looks up Australian companies by ABN, ACN or company name against the ASIC Company Register — about 4 million companies.

It spends your money. USD 0.01 per successful lookup, paid automatically from a wallet you configure. A lookup that matches nothing is free, and so is a malformed one. There is no account and no API key: the payment is the credential, under the x402 protocol, in USDC on Base mainnet.

The server will not start until you have told it a total spend cap.

Install

Nothing to install. Point your MCP client at it with npx and it fetches on first run.

npx @nightshiftbuilds/asic-lookup-mcp is how it runs.

You need a Base mainnet wallet holding a little USDC. You do not need ETH: x402 exact payments are an off-chain EIP-3009 signature settled by a facilitator, so your wallet signs and pays no gas.

The key file

PRIVATE_KEY_FILE is preferred over PRIVATE_KEY because a client config file is not a good home for a wallet key — it gets synced, backed up and shared in screenshots.

mkdir -p ~/.config/asic-lookup
printf '0x%s' "$YOUR_KEY_WITHOUT_0X" > ~/.config/asic-lookup/key
chmod 600 ~/.config/asic-lookup/key

Configuration

VariableRequiredDefaultWhat it does
SPEND_CAP_USDyesnoneTotal USD this server may spend before it refuses every further lookup. Roughly 100 lookups per dollar. There is deliberately no default.
PRIVATE_KEY_FILEone of these twoPath to a file containing the wallet's private key.
PRIVATE_KEYone of these twoThe key itself, 0x + 64 hex characters.
MAX_PRICE_USD_PER_CALLno0.01The most one lookup may cost. A 402 asking for more is refused, not paid.
REQUEST_TIMEOUT_MSno45000How long to wait for the API, per network attempt. The paid retry gets its own budget rather than the leftovers of the unpaid one, so a paid lookup's worst case is roughly twice this. 1000–300000.
EXPECTED_PAY_TOnothe endpoint's published payeeThe only address this server will sign a transfer to. Change it only with API_BASE_URL, and only deliberately.
MAX_AUTHORISATION_SECONDSno600The longest a signature this server produces may stay spendable. A 402 asking for more is refused. 30–3600.
API_BASE_URLnohttps://api.nightshiftbuilds.comOverride the endpoint. Must be https.

The cap is counted per server process. Restarting the server resets it, which is worth knowing if your client restarts servers often.

The tool

lookup_australian_company — give exactly one of:

ArgumentMeaning
abnAustralian Business Number, 11 digits. Spaces and hyphens are ignored.
acnAustralian Company Number, 9 digits. Spaces and hyphens are ignored.
nameCompany name, matched as a prefix, case insensitive.
limitMaximum results for a name search, 1–25. Does not change the price.

They are alternative ways to identify one company, not filters that combine, so passing two is an error rather than a narrower search.

Returns, per match: registered name, ACN or ARBN, ABN, registration status, entity type and class, registration and deregistration dates, previous state of registration, state registration number, and former names. Plus what the lookup cost, the Base settlement transaction hash, and your running total against the cap.

What it does not have

Asking for these will not work, because the underlying dataset does not contain them:

  • GST registration status, business address, state or postcode — those live in the Australian Business Register extract, a different dataset
  • directors, officeholders or shareholders
  • trading names, financial data
  • anything about a sole trader or partnership that is not a registered company

It is also a weekly snapshot, not the official register. ASIC Connect is authoritative for anything that matters legally.

How the money works

Every lookup is one HTTP request that comes back 402 Payment Required with a price, a payee and a token. The server signs an EIP-3009 authorisation for exactly that amount and retries. A facilitator settles it on Base and the answer comes back with the transaction hash.

Five separate limits sit in front of your signing key:

  1. Only Base mainnet. No scheme client is registered for any other chain, so a 402 naming one has nothing that could sign it.
  2. Only USDC, only the exact scheme, only an EIP-3009 transfer, and only up to MAX_PRICE_USD_PER_CALL — checked against what the endpoint actually asked for, not against what it asked for last time. A 402 is free to demand any number it likes; the number inside the signature is the one that leaves your wallet, so that is the number that gets checked. A 402 that tries to steer the signature onto Permit2 or an escrow flow is refused rather than signed.
  3. Only EXPECTED_PAY_TO. The payee is pinned, not merely checked for being a well-formed address, so a hijacked endpoint cannot redirect your payments to itself within the ceiling.
  4. Only for MAX_AUTHORISATION_SECONDS. A signature is spendable until its validBefore, and the 402 names that. Unbounded, a 402 can obtain an authorisation valid for centuries; here anything over ten minutes is refused.
  5. SPEND_CAP_USD in total, counted against signatures rather than settlements. The reservation is taken before the request is sent, so concurrent lookups cannot collectively overrun it.

On the accounting. What leaves a wallet is a signature, not a settlement, so that is what the cap counts. A 404 costs nothing — but the authorisation it signed is still in the payee's hands and still settleable, so the amount stays held against the cap until its validBefore passes, and the spend line says so. Ten thousand "free" misses cannot hand out more live authorisations than your cap. Anything that ends after a signature exists — a timeout, a dropped body, a 409, a 503 of unknown outcome — is charged, not released, because a signature in someone else's hands is not a refund. After one of those, the identical query is refused until the authorisation expires: retrying it would sign a second one.

Nothing is broadcast from your machine, and the key is never logged, never returned in a tool result and never included in an error message.

Data licence and attribution

The data this server returns contains ASIC Company Register data sourced from data.gov.au, © Australian Securities and Investments Commission, licensed under CC BY 3.0 AU.

That attribution is a condition of the licence, not decoration. It ships in every tool result so it travels with the data. Keep it if you redistribute what you get back.

The full dataset is free to download from data.gov.au. This is a lookup service, not a way to obtain the dataset, and there is no cheaper path to a bulk copy through it.

Development

npm install
npm test          # 139 tests: no wallet needed, no money spent
npm run build

The suite mocks the 402 handshake with a challenge recorded from the live endpoint and asserts what actually gets signed — the amount, the payee, the token, the chain, the authorisation lifetime, and that the signature recovers to the configured wallet. Both wire versions are exercised end to end. The accounting tests run against a fetch that really signs, so they can tell "nothing was charged" from "nothing was signed"; every spend-safety fix has a test that fails when the fix is reverted. One test hits the real API unpaid to read its published price, which is free by design; set SKIP_LIVE_TESTS=1 to skip it offline.
